Ingredients
-
3 tablespoons olive oil (divided)
-
1/2 teaspoon curry powder
-
1/4 teaspoon cumin powder
-
1 1/2 inches piece ginger (about the thickness of a thumb, peeled and minced)
-
3 garlic cloves (minced)
-
1/8 teaspoon cayenne
-
1/2 teaspoon salt
-
3 shallots (slivered)
-
1 tablespoon tomato paste
-
3/4 cup water
-
1 tablespoon brown sugar
-
cilantro leaf
-
flat bread
-
cooked rice
-
lemons or lime wedge
-
1 1/2 lbs large raw shrimp (shelled and cleaned)
Instructions
- Marinate shrimp in 1 1/2 T olive oil, curry powder, cumin, minced ginger, minced garlic, cayenne, and salt for 1/2 hour.
- Saute shallots in oil, in a heavy skillet over medium heat, stirring frequently, for about 2 minutes.
- Stir in tomato paste, water, and brown sugar. Bring to a simmer.
- Add shrimp mixture and cook until shrimp are just cooked through, 3-4 minutes.
- Sprinkle with cilantro, and serve with lemon or lime wedges and flat bread, or over rice.
